1. Unique Proteins and Microbes
One key factor lies in the composition of semen, which contains proteins and microbes specific to the paternal lineage. These unique components play a vital role in preparing the maternal immune system for potential encounters during pregnancy.
2. Priming the Immune Response
Exposure to paternal cells and proteins before conception can help prime the maternal immune response. This pre-pregnancy exposure allows the immune system to familiarize itself with these materials, potentially leading to a more robust defense during pregnancy.
3. Building Immunity Against Preeclampsia
Research suggests that increased exposure to paternal cells and proteins in semen could aid in building immunity against conditions such as preeclampsia. This phenomenon highlights the complex interplay between the paternal contribution and maternal health during pregnancy.

7. Sperm Quality and Pregnancy Outcomes
The quality of sperm, including factors like motility and morphology, can impact pregnancy outcomes. Healthy sperm are more likely to successfully fertilize the egg and support the early stages of embryonic growth.
8. Epigenetic Influences
Recent studies have highlighted the role of sperm in epigenetic influences on offspring development. Sperm can carry epigenetic markers that may affect gene expression and phenotype, shaping the future health of the child.
